First, understand your options. Brownsville's climate brings all four seasons, with cold winters and humid summers. This makes indoor storage, like a climate-controlled unit, ideal for preventing weather damage and freeze-thaw cycle issues. However, for true cheap boat storage, consider covered outdoor storage or even secure, uncovered lots. Many local marinas and storage facilities along the riverfront offer seasonal rates that are more affordable than you might think. The key is to book early, especially for winter storage, as spots fill up fast after Labor Day.
Think beyond traditional facilities. Look into local farmers or landowners with unused barns or large, secure outbuildings. The rural areas surrounding Brownsville can be a goldmine for private, cheap boat storage arrangements. Always ensure any private space is dry, secure from theft, and has clear access for your trailer. A simple written agreement is wise for both parties.
Maximize your savings by preparing your boat properly. A well-winterized boat stored outdoors under a quality, fitted cover will fare better and may allow you to choose a cheaper, uncovered option. Remove all valuables, electronics, and drain all water systems to prevent winter damage. This proactive care reduces the risk of costly repairs, making a cheaper storage spot a viable, safe choice.
Don't forget to factor in accessibility. A cheap storage spot an hour away might cost you more in fuel and time than a slightly pricier one closer to the Dunlap Creek or Brownsville Boat Launch. Call around to facilities in West Brownsville or neighboring Grindstone to compare. Often, paying for a 6-month contract upfront can secure a significant discount compared to month-to-month rates.
